Course Details

Fundamentals of Food Systems Economics: An introductory unit covering key economic concepts and their application in food systems.
Global Food Systems and Markets: Understanding the structure, trends, and challenges of the global food system, including production, processing, distribution, and consumption.
Agricultural Economics: Examining the economics of agricultural production, farm management, and policy analysis.
Food Systems Policy and Governance: Investigating the role of policy and governance in shaping food systems, including the impact on food security, sustainability, and equity.
Supply Chain Management in Food Systems: Exploring the management of food supply chains, including logistics, distribution, and inventory management.
Food Systems and Sustainable Development: Examining the relationship between food systems and sustainable development, including the role of food systems in achieving the Sustainable Development Goals.
Food Systems Data Analysis: Developing skills in data analysis and interpretation for food systems, including the use of statistical tools and data visualization techniques.
Food Systems Entrepreneurship and Innovation: Exploring opportunities for entrepreneurship and innovation in food systems, including the development of new business models, technologies, and partnerships.
Ethics and Social Responsibility in Food Systems: Investigating ethical and social responsibility considerations in food systems, including labor rights, animal welfare, and environmental stewardship.
